Application Guideline: Call for TDR International Postgraduate Scholarship Master 3rd batch

Faculty of Medicine, Universitas Gadjah Mada (UGM), Yogyakarta, Indonesia invites suitably qualified candidates to apply for a place in the following full-time postgraduate programmes, with a focus on Implementation Research for the 2017-2018 academic year.
The scheme, which is provided by TDR, the Special Programme for Research and Training in Tropical Diseases based at the World Health Organization in Geneva, Switzerland, provides full scholarship (http://www.who.int/tdr/capacity/strengthening/postgraduate/en/). Only applicants from low and middle-income countries of WHO South-East Asia and West Pacific regions are eligible.

The training will be focused on courses relevant to a career in implementation research on infectious disease of poverty. Implementation research is a growing field that supports the identification of health system bottlenecks and approaches to address them, and is particularly useful in low- and middle- income countries where many health interventions do not research those who need them the most. The goal of this scheme is to enhance postgraduate training capacity and boost the number of researchers in low and middle- income countries.

Further information on implementation research is available from:
www.who.int/tdr/publications/topics/ir-toolkit/en/

Limited number of scholarships will be offered for the 2017/2018 academic year in the International Master Programme in Public Health, leading to a MPH degree (2 years duration). The programme is taught in English. Recipients will be enrolled as postgraduate students, and their careers will be tracked with the new TDR Global alumni and stakeholder platform that will be launched in the next year, providing ongoing monitoring of the impact of the programme, as well as networking and increased visibility opportunities for students.
 
 

ELIGIBILITY

  • Nationals and residences from low- and middle income countries (data.worldbank.org/about/country-and-lending-groups) of WHO South-East Asia and West Pacific regions.
  • Applicants should normally be under 35 years old for the Master programme.
  • Meet the standard University requirements for international postgraduate students (graduate.fk.ugm.ac.id).

 

SCHOLARSHIP

  • Return economy airfare between the home country of the student and Yogyakarta, Indonesia.
  • Tuition fees and a basic medical and accident insurance.
  • Support for research project/thesis expenses, including travel and sustenance during data collection in home country.
  • Indonesian language course to improve integration in the university’s environment.
  • Monthly stipend to cover living expenses equivalent to local living cost.
